20 of the highest-paid entry-level retail jobs in the US, from Aldi to Zara

Entry-level jobs at these 20 retail chains start at $17.25 an hour, according to Glassdoor data on hourly wages of companies in the US.

Why This Matters

The rising wage floor for entry-level retail roles reflects broader labor market pressures, where even traditionally low-paying sectors must compete for talent amid persistent inflation and worker demands for better compensation. For job seekers, these figures signal an opportunity to secure livable wages without prior experience, while for employers, it underscores the financial strain of balancing profitability with retention in a tight labor market.

Background Context

The retail industryโ€™s shift toward higher starting wages comes after years of criticism over stagnant pay and exploitative scheduling practices, particularly during the pandemic when frontline workers faced increased health risks with minimal compensation. States like California and New York have led the charge with higher minimum wages, but private employersโ€”even in regions with lower statutory floorsโ€”are now preemptively raising pay to attract workers in a fiercely competitive job market.

What Happens Next

If these wage trends hold, retail could see a bifurcation where high-turnover, low-wage roles become scarcer as companies automate or consolidate, while employers offering competitive entry-level pay may struggle to sustain margins without raising prices or reducing staffing. Watch for ripple effects in adjacent industries, where workers priced out of retail might push for similar wage hikes elsewhere, or employers could double down on automation to offset labor costs.
